About the job
As Data Center Project Coordinator – will work closely with the various teams across Bray to successfully identify, track, and provide sales alignment to further Bray’s commercial success in the vertical market. The Project Coordinator will be responsible to maintain owner/EPC design standards for guidance to the regional sales team members, and to be a liaison with the estimating department on bid proposals. This position will provide greater accountability and success by aligning strategic projects, and applications across multiple regions. The role requires a broad range of skills – familiarity with construction life-cycle, mechanical & controls scopes of an HVAC system, and the ability to manage cross functional teams from sales to supply chain operations.
Responsibilities
- Liaison between VP Data Centers, and the key territory stakeholders on target projects or customers.
- Identifying key project or target accounts utilizing construction services (CMD Insight, Industrial Info Resources) for assignment in CRM.
- Acting as a central point of information on design standards for leading owners, OEM’s, and system design topography.
- Coordinating project requirements with supply chain operation for material forecasts.
- Recording and managing historical project data to assist in future project negotiation, and marketing efforts.
- Understanding strategic business needs and plans for growth.
Skills & Experience
- Proficiency in CRM (Microsoft Dynamics).
- Competency in HVAC, fluid hydronics, or valve manufacturing is a plus.
- Proven ability to work independently and as a team member.
- Good communication (written and oral) and interpersonal skills.
- Good organizational, multi-tasking, and time-management skills.
- Manage stakeholder communication and progress reporting (pipeline reviews)
- Ability to negotiate and shape a deal including understanding pricing and risk.
- Understanding the difference between “nuts and bolts” vs. bits and bytes” of a Data Center.
Education
-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, BA, or related field required
- Minimum of 5+ years highly relevant work experience.
Bray International, Inc. is a leading global manufacturer of industrial and commercial valves, actuators and related control products used by process industries and the non-residential building market in a wide variety of applications. This diverse market presence provides stability under even the toughest economic circumstances. Bray prides itself on delivering products of the highest quality and value, with an ever-expanding product line that aims to satisfy our customers’ unique needs. Since it’s founding in 1986, Bray has achieved tremendous success and growth. The company’s truly entrepreneurial vision has driven an expansion to Divisions in over 13 countries and a distribution network that surpasses 300 locations worldwide.
